STIPULATION TO DISMISS PLAINTIFF’S SECOND CAUSE OF ACTION; AND ORDER 14 15 16 UNITED STATES OF AMERICA and DOES 1 through 100 inclusive, Defendants. 17 18 Plaintiff Laura Hebert-Torres, by and through her attorney of record, and the United States, by 19 and through its attorneys of record, hereby stipulate, subject to approval of the Court, to dismissal of 20 Plaintiff’s Second Cause of Action in her Complaint. In her Second Cause of Action, Hebert-Torres 21 alleges that the United States violated 42 U.S.C. § 1395dd and California Health and Safety Code § 22 1317 et seq., when a nurse practitioner at the Del Norte Clinic allegedly failed to perform an 23 appropriate screening examination to determine whether Hebert-Torres had an emergency medical 24 condition and failed to stabilize Hebert-Torres prior to sending her home. Complaint ¶¶ 29-33. The 25 parties agree that because neither 42 U.S.C. § 1395dd nor California Health and Safety Code § 1317 26 contain an express waiver of sovereign immunity, the Court lacks subject matter jurisdiction over the 27 Second Cause of Action in the Complaint. 28 1 1 Dated: May 26, 2011 2 Respectfully submitted, BENJAMIN B.
